Police capture first ‘international’ criminal
Updated: 16-Dec-2004

Judicial Police have announced that they have detained a 50-year-old man in Vila Real de Santo António, via a European detention order, on suspicion of involvement in fraud and forgery in Spain. They describe the crimes as being of “international dimensions”.

“This is the first case related to the European detention order,” said a spokesman from the Judicial Police, referring to the new anti-terrorist measure that came into force earlier this year.

Police confirmed that, thanks to the new document, it was possible to begin extradition proceedings immediately, in accordance with the wishes of Spanish authorities.
